Eye injuries down in women's lacrosse
POSTED: December 16, 2011
NEW YORK (Reuters Health) - Eye injuries among female lacrosse players dropped dramatically after US Lacrosse, the governing board for the sport, required protective eyewear in 2004, according to a study published online December 8 in The American Journal of Sports Medicine.

Macular degeneration rates similar for Asian ethnic groups
POSTED: December 13, 2011
NEW YORK (Reuters Health) - Rates of age-related macular degeneration (AMD) are similar across Asia's three main ethnic groups, according to a report online yesterday in Archives of Ophthalmology.

Glaucoma a risk with modern infant aphakia surgery
POSTED: December 9, 2011
NEW YORK (Reuters Health) - Modern surgical techniques don't completely eliminate the risk of glaucoma in children who have cataract surgery, a new report says.

Operation on both eyelids yields better ptosis results
POSTED: November 30, 2011
NEW YORK (Reuters Health) - When patients with ptosis demonstrate Hering's effect -- that is, lifting the affected eyelid causes the contralateral lid to droop -- operating on both eyes at once yields better results than sequential procedures, a new study shows.
